179811900968139 is an odd composite number. It is composed of five dist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two hundred eighty-e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 179811900968139:

33 × 11 × 192 × 372 × 1073

(3 × 3 × 3 × 11 × 19 × 19 × 37 × 37 × 107 × 107 × 107)
